Removing open-cell spray foam can seem like a daunting task, but with the right tools and techniques, you can successfully tackle this sticky situation. Initiate by evaluating the scope of the project and gathering the necessary equipment. Safety should always be your top priority, so wear safety gear like gloves, a mask, and eye glasses. Once you're prepared, you can execute various removal methods depending on the degree of foam presence.

  • Think about using a razor blade to carefully remove small areas of foam.
  • If larger areas, consider renting a specialized foam removal tool. This method involves heating the foam to make it easier to extract.
  • Keep in mind some foams may require chemical reagents for effective removal. Always comply with the manufacturer's instructions and safety precautions when using chemicals.

Upon completion of the removal process, thoroughly clean the area eliminating any remaining foam residue. Consult a professional if you encounter any difficulties or surprising challenges during the removal process.

Efficient and Reliable Closed-Cell Spray Foam Removal Solutions

Closed-cell spray foam removal can be a complex process, requiring specialized tools and techniques. It's important to choose safe and effective solutions to minimize damage to your property and protect your health. Chemical methods are often employed for removal, each with its own pros and cons.

A common mechanical method involves the use of a scraper to carefully remove the foam layer by layer. This approach can be labor-intensive but is effective for smaller get more info areas. For larger installations, thermal removal methods like heat guns or torches may be more practical. These techniques melt the foam, making it easier to scrape away.

Chemical strippers are also available for closed-cell spray foam removal. These solutions dissolve the foam, allowing for easier removal. However, it's essential to choose a stripper specifically designed for closed-cell foam and to follow manufacturer instructions carefully.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), including gloves, eye protection, and respiratory protection, when working with chemicals.

Ultimately, the best closed-cell spray foam removal solution will depend on factors such as the size of the installation, the type of substrate, and your budget.

Removing Closed-Cell Spray Foam: Maximizing Building Efficiency

Closed-cell spray foam insulation provides exceptional value for building efficiency, but there are instances where its displacement becomes necessary. Whether due to damage, changes in building plans, or unforeseen issues, understanding the methodology of closed-cell foam removal is crucial for achieving optimal results. Starting with any removal project, it's imperative to seek advice from an experienced contractor who specializes in spray foam insulation. They can evaluate the scope of the removal required and formulate a safe and effective plan.

During the removal process, safety should be the utmost priority. Proper personal protective equipment protective clothing must be worn to prevent exposure to potentially harmful substances. Moreover, adequate ventilation is essential to reduce the risk of inhaling fumes or dust particles.

Once the foam has been removed, it's important to thoroughly clean the affected area. This promotes a healthy and clean space for future construction or renovations.

Implementing proper waste disposal is also crucial. Contact your local recycling center for guidance on the suitable handling techniques for removed closed-cell spray foam. By observing these recommendations, you can optimize energy performance while ensuring a safe and sustainable outcome.
